O H Arnold Park is a park in Oklahoma, at a recorded 332 m. Carlton Mountain stands 537 m to the west-northwest, 8.9 miles off. The nearest named place is Vernon Park, a park 0.3 miles away. Wichita Mountains Byway passes 6.8 miles off.

Local time (America/Chicago).
Months averaging 50–80 °F: Mar–Jun, Sep–Nov.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 40 | 44 | 53 | 61 | 70 | 79 | 84 | 84 | 75 | 63 | 51 | 42 |
| Precip in | 1.2 | 1.7 | 2.4 | 3.3 | 5.0 | 4.2 | 2.9 | 3.5 | 3.1 | 2.9 | 2.1 | 1.9 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Lawton, 4 mi away.
